Read context or promise values with the `use` API.
Section: Performance and Concurrency Hooks
use API with context or promise
tsx
tsx
const theme = use(ThemeContext);
const product = use(productPromise);Explanation
The `use` API can read context or suspend on promises in supported React environments.
Learn the surrounding workflow
Compare similar commands or jump into common fixes when this command is part of a bigger troubleshooting path.
Related commands
Same sheet · prioritizing Performance and Concurrency Hooks
useDeferredValue delay expensive rendering
Defer a value so expensive children lag behind urgent input.
useSyncExternalStore subscribe to external state
Read and subscribe to an external store consistently.